Maggie Weisen, Charis Pregnancy Help Center

Maggie has been the driving force behind starting Charis Pregnancy Help Center. Vision – Charis will offer pregnancy options education in a non-judgmental; Christ centered environment; giving hope to those who don’t know where to turn and helping to break generational cycles of dysfunction by responsibly distributing resources that are “earned”. Maggie has been a RN since 1984. She is basing Charis, which means grace, on the Hospice program. The program should be up and running by July 1st. All services are confidential and will be at no cost to the clients. The Help Center will be a clinic that specializes in pregnancy diagnosis and pregnancy decisions. All medical services are provided under the supervision of a Wisconsin licensed physician. Services include pregnancy testing, obstetrical ultrasounds, medical referrals and reproductive health information. Charis does not perform or refer for abortions. Fund raising includes coins in baby bottle, baby showers and bake sales. They will take no government funding.
